# Artifact Signing — Furrowlink Gateway

The Furrowlink telemetry gateway sits on tractors in the field, so we're strict about firmware provenance: every artifact gets signed at build time and the gateway refuses unsigned images outright. Reviewers, check that the build step signs the full bundle, not just the manifest — we got burned on that once. Local verification uses the same keypair as CI. For reference, the current signing key is below.

release key, hadug-kawef: bky13_mPGeFZeR1GZ1G

### Changed defaults

New tables created through the Lattervane storage API are now partitioned by calendar month instead of by week. Weekly partitioning produced excessive catalog overhead for low-volume plugin datasets, and most retention policies are expressed in months anyway. Existing tables are unaffected; a migration helper is available in the tooling package. Plugins that assumed weekly partition names in raw queries must switch to the month-based naming scheme. The partitioning subsystem now ships with the following defaults.

service settings:
PRAWYN_PIN=9848
PRAWYN_METRICS_HOST=metrics.prawyn.lumicworks.corp
PRAWYN_LOG_LEVEL=warn
PRAWYN_TENANT=pelius

Ticket: Staging env misconfigured for Siftgate bloom filter

The bloom layer in front of the Pellet KV store is rejecting all lookups in staging because the env file was copied from the dev template without credentials. False-positive tuning values are fine; only the auth line is missing. To unblock the weekly demo, the Pellet admission secret must be set on the following line.

env line for yaguf-fajop: LEDGER_TOKEN13=fb08984397349